Adjective [English]

Etymology: From Medieval Latin volitivus (from volo (“want”) + -ivus), a Scholastic translation of the Ancient Greek θελητικός (thelētikós), from θέλησις (thélēsis, “a will, a willing”).   1. Of or pertaining the will or volition. Tags: not-comparable

  2. (grammar, of a verb) In the volitive; expressing a wish. Tags: not-comparable Categories (topical): Grammar

  1. (uncountable, linguistics) A verb form found in certain languages which indicates that a certain action is willed, although it may not be performed in fact. Tags: uncountable Categories (topical): Linguistics
